Computer-generated methods prove ideal for creating and enhancing celestial subjects, as actual space photography often requires extensive processing to achieve visually compelling results. Raw astronomical images typically appear relatively monochromatic and require false color application, contrast enhancement, and compositional refinement before becoming decoratively suitable. Artists skilled in these enhancement techniques can transform scientific source material into stunning artwork that maintains astronomical accuracy while achieving decorative beauty. The results educate and inspire while providing visual pleasure through their chromatic richness and compositional drama.

The chromatic possibilities within cosmic subjects range from relatively realistic blues, whites, and blacks to wildly vibrant purples, magentas, oranges, and greens that characterize false-color astronomical imaging. These intense hues derive from scientific imaging techniques that assign colors to different wavelengths including non-visible spectra, creating visually dramatic representations that communicate scientific information while achieving striking beauty. Artists can emphasize or moderate these chromatic intensities depending on desired decorative effects, creating versions ranging from subtly moody to vibrantly psychedelic. This flexibility allows cosmic artwork to suit various interior contexts from restrained minimalist spaces to bold maximalist environments. Pattern traditions from various cultures provide rich visual vocabularies that translate beautifully through computer-generated methods. Islamic geometric patterns featuring intricate mathematical relationships and arabesques create mesmerizing complexity that electronic precision renders perfectly. African textile patterns including mud cloth designs, kente cloth geometries, and various tribal motifs bring bold graphics and cultural significance. Asian decorative traditions including Japanese wave patterns, Chinese cloud motifs, and Indian paisley all offer distinctive aesthetics with deep cultural roots. Latin American folk art traditions feature vibrant colors and joyful subjects that bring energy and optimism. These various pattern vocabularies enriched through centuries of cultural development provide alternatives to Western artistic dominance that has historically characterized mainstream art markets.

Installation and Display Considerations Specific to Computer-Generated Artwork Characteristics
Computer-generated artwork typically arrives as high-quality prints on various substrates rather than original unique objects, affecting display and preservation considerations. Canvas prints represent the most popular format, offering texture and weight that creates substantial physical presence despite reproduced rather than hand-created origins. The canvas material allows gallery wrap presentation where images extend around frame edges, eliminating needs for additional framing while creating three-dimensional objects rather than flat prints. Stretcher bar quality significantly affects final results; substantial wooden frames prevent warping while cheap thin bars risk sagging that distorts images. Museum-quality stretcher bars represent worthy upgrades ensuring prints maintain proper tension and flatness throughout extended display periods.
Paper prints offer alternative presentations suited to framed display behind glass or acrylic protection. Fine art papers including cotton rag, watercolor paper, and specialty media provide archival qualities ensuring longevity while offering textural variety that affects final appearances. Smooth papers create sharp detail rendering ideal for precise geometric or photographic work, while textured papers introduce organic surface qualities that complement certain subjects and styles. The framing process for paper prints involves additional decisions regarding matting, which creates visual breathing room while protecting prints from direct glass contact. Mat colors dramatically affect how artwork appears; white mats create clean modern presentations, while cream or off-white options introduce warmth. Colored mats can either complement artwork colors or provide deliberate contrasts that emphasize specific hues within compositions.
Metal and acrylic prints represent contemporary alternatives offering distinctive modern aesthetics. Metal prints infuse images into aluminum surfaces creating luminous appearances with exceptional sharpness and vibrant colors. The metal substrate provides inherent durability while the frameless presentation creates sleek contemporary looks suited to modern interiors. Acrylic prints sandwich images between clear acrylic layers creating dimensional depth and glass-like clarity with superior impact resistance compared to actual glass. These premium presentation methods command higher prices but deliver exceptional visual impact and longevity that justify investments for important pieces. The choice between various printing substrates depends on budget considerations, aesthetic preferences, and desired longevity, as archival quality varies substantially between different materials and production methods.
